Why Is My Car’s A/C Not Blowing Cold Air? 

In The Woodlands, TX, where summer temperatures can rise quickly, a properly working A/C system is essential for comfortable driving. If your car’s A/C is no longer blowing cold air, it may be due to a variety of underlying issues. 

What Causes a Car A/C to Stop Cooling? 

Common causes include: 

  • Low refrigerant levels  
  • Compressor problems  
  • Condenser blockages or damage  
  • Electrical faults  
  • Cabin air filter restrictions  

Each of these can reduce cooling performance or stop it entirely. 

Is Low Refrigerant a Common Issue? 

Yes. Low refrigerant is one of the most frequent reasons drivers lose cold air. It often points to a leak that should be addressed during a professional inspection. 

What Are Signs of a Bad Compressor? 

You may notice: 

  • Inconsistent cooling  
  • Strange noises when A/C is running  
  • System cycling on and off  

A failing compressor can prevent your A/C from functioning properly. 

Can Airflow Problems Affect Cooling? 

Absolutely. A clogged cabin air filter can reduce airflow, making it seem like the A/C isn’t working—even if it is cooling.
